Frequently Asked Questions About Fort Lauderdale, FL

What is it like to live in Coral Ridge, Fort Lauderdale, FL?

Living in Coral Ridge offers a mix of suburban charm and urban convenience, featuring tree-lined streets, parks, and waterways. The community is known for its affluent residential neighborhoods, proximity to the beach, and access to shopping and dining options, making it appealing for families and retirees alike.

Is Coral Ridge, Fort Lauderdale, FL expensive?

Coral Ridge is considered an upscale neighborhood in Fort Lauderdale, with a higher cost of living compared to the city average. Home prices and rents tend to be reflective of the area's desirable location, amenities, and waterfront access.

What is the weather of Coral Ridge, Fort Lauderdale, FL?

Coral Ridge experiences a tropical rainforest climate, characterized by warm temperatures year-round and significant rainfall during the summer months. Average highs range from the upper 70s to mid-90s Fahrenheit, while winters are mild and dry.

How safe is Coral Ridge, Fort Lauderdale, FL?

Coral Ridge is generally considered a safe neighborhood in Fort Lauderdale, with crime rates lower than the national average for similar urban areas. Community engagement and active neighborhood watch programs contribute to its safety.
